Основные компоненты Android: Activity, Service, Content provider и Broadcast receiver на практике

  Рет қаралды 2,630

Maxim Likhachev - Learn

Maxim Likhachev - Learn

Күн бұрын

Перезалито с основного канала!
Как и обещал выпускаю ролик про основные компоненты Android. В видео мы кратко пробежимся по теории, узнаем, что такое Activity, Service, Content Provider и Broadcast Receiver и затем рассмотрим все это на практике и естественно на Kotlin. По теории я пробежался очень поверхностно дабы сэкономить время + manifest.xml файла коснулся только в контексте основных компонентов android.
Не забудь поставить лайк и оставить комментарий) Это здорово поможет развитию канала :)
👇👇👇 ТАЙМ-КОДЫ 👇👇👇
0:00 - вступление
0:55 - основные компоненты Android
1:25 - activity
2:11 - service
2:52 - content provider
3:26 - broadcast receiver
4:10 - создаем приложение android
5:25 - android activity example
6:27 - жизненный цикл activity
18:29 - android service example
28:47 - android content provider example
46:35 - android broadcast receiver example
50:46 - заключение
КАК Я СТАЛ ПРОГРАММИСТОМ
• Video
Друзья, лучшей благодарностью и мотивацией для меня делать новые видео будет ваш лайк и подписка. Так же хочу сказать, что видео я снимаю на чистом энтузиазме и никакого дохода с них не имею. Все сказанное в данном ролике является моим личным мнением и оценочным суждением. Так же не стоит забывать, что я не являюсь разработчиком с многолетним опытом и во многом могу ошибаться.
👍 Не забудьте поставить лайк и подписаться на канал! Это бесплатно и помогает мне создавать новый контент.
📬 Мои соц сети:
➡️ KZfaq Maxim Likhachev: / @mvlikhachev
➡️ KZfaq Maxim Likhachev | Learn: / @maximlikhachevlearn
➡️ Telegram: t.me/mvlikhachev
➡️ My CV: mvlikhachev.com/
➡️ Instagram: / mv.likhachev
➡️ Threads: www.threads.net/@mv.likhachev
➡️ Twitter: / wwwqwwwq
💸 Поддержать проект:
USDT: TQa62XGkzEn1hykAeUTye6GrsRQLB26kW7
BTC: 1E8ifH213NNEbMeRQf4wk8REbkd6a3qt8h

Пікірлер: 16
@alexv583
@alexv583 2 ай бұрын
Максим! Больше всего понравился подход от общего к деталям. Что ты сначала говоришь, что собираешься делать и для чего, а потом начинаешь писать и объяснять.
@luide2167
@luide2167 4 ай бұрын
Это додуматься надо такой контент с максимум 720р выкладывать. Я как самый начинающий во многих местах просто преписываю и кое где не понять, что написано из за разрешения. Бесит!АААААА!!!1111 А так Лайк
@MaximLikhachevLearn
@MaximLikhachevLearn 4 ай бұрын
Сорян, эти ролики очень давно записывал с экрана макбука)
@Frestein
@Frestein 8 ай бұрын
Свитер офигенный. Спасибо за ролик!
@bigpiglove
@bigpiglove 8 ай бұрын
Максим, спасибо за контент! Из русскоязычных блогеров я нахожу твои уроки наиболее понятными и без пафоса. Продолжай плиз!
@MaximLikhachevLearn
@MaximLikhachevLearn 8 ай бұрын
Как только появляется свободное время)
@android-rg8ty
@android-rg8ty 9 ай бұрын
18:35 сервис 28:50 Content provider
@user-sr7iz9yk6p
@user-sr7iz9yk6p 9 ай бұрын
Спасибо за урок! Очень нужная тема.
@nikson9334
@nikson9334 4 ай бұрын
Как-то всё подозрительно просто и понятно , не верю )
@luckytima2315
@luckytima2315 8 ай бұрын
Братик спасибо ! Можно побольше видосиков для начинаюних
@Mecenatt
@Mecenatt 5 күн бұрын
Вроде бы jetpack compose избавляет от второй и последующих активити , достаточно лишь создавать компануемые функции , но с другой стороны из компануемой функции нельзя вызвать другую компонуемую функцию . Получается идиотизм и приходится городить огороды или использовать библиотеки типа навигейшин.
@oleg-eK3xhZov
@oleg-eK3xhZov Ай бұрын
Еще вопрос: в андроид 9.0 и выше broadcastReceiver стал для красоты ? только для вывода toast оповещений ?У меня в андроид 7.0 удалось запустить MainActivity из broadcastReceiver а в других андроидах не получается
@oleg-eK3xhZov
@oleg-eK3xhZov Ай бұрын
Привет.А можешь подсказать почему при запуске простого активити onResume вызывается дважды(вижу по логам).Я уже сделал костыли чтобы реагировать только на первый вызов onResume
@vitiyz803vitiyz
@vitiyz803vitiyz 9 ай бұрын
Спасибо, полезно было очень. Из предложений, увеличивать бы код, а то я на своем ноуте 2к - 17,3 дюйма, не так что прямо хорошо вижу, на более маленьких устройствах еще хуже будет видно.
@MaximLikhachevLearn
@MaximLikhachevLearn 9 ай бұрын
это перезаливы старых видео, новые я пишу на 2к мониторе и там все видно хорошо)
@user-zg6qy8oi7j
@user-zg6qy8oi7j 6 ай бұрын
Слишком быстро разговариваешь , остальные всё норм))))
Broadcasts & Broadcast Receivers - Android Basics 2023
11:33
Philipp Lackner
Рет қаралды 45 М.
small vs big hoop #tiktok
00:12
Анастасия Тарасова
Рет қаралды 24 МЛН
We Got Expelled From Scholl After This...
00:10
Jojo Sim
Рет қаралды 73 МЛН
FOOLED THE GUARD🤢
00:54
INO
Рет қаралды 62 МЛН
Неприятная Встреча На Мосту - Полярная звезда #shorts
00:59
Полярная звезда - Kuzey Yıldızı
Рет қаралды 7 МЛН
03. Базовые компоненты - Михаил Козлов
58:22
Yandex for Developers
Рет қаралды 7 М.
Content Providers - Android Basics 2023
22:40
Philipp Lackner
Рет қаралды 33 М.
KMP Navegação Nativa e ViewModel Nativo Compose Multiplatform Part2
12:29
Собеседование в Яндекс. Платформа Android
2:09:43
Android Broadcast. Все об Андроид разработке
Рет қаралды 20 М.
MVVM в Android на практике
41:32
Тимофей Коваленко
Рет қаралды 46 М.
small vs big hoop #tiktok
00:12
Анастасия Тарасова
Рет қаралды 24 МЛН